The Korea Road Traffic Authority has issued a special warning to drivers and passengers, revealing that the interior surface temperature of vehicles parked outdoors for extended periods in scorching heat soared up to 85.5 degrees Celsius.
According to the authority's measurements taken after parking vehicles outdoors for about 4 hours in a 34°C (93°F) environment on the 5th, the dashboard temperature of a black vehicle reached a maximum of 85.5°C (186°F), while that of a white vehicle rose up to 73.7°C (165°F), showing a difference of about 12 degrees depending on the vehicle color.
The authority explained that because the inside of a vehicle heats up rapidly in a short period of time, sufficient ventilation and air conditioning are necessary before boarding.
